**Ticket NB-1142: Nightfill scheduler skips partitions after DST shift**

The Nightfill backfill scheduler silently skipped two hourly partitions during the clock change. Suspect the cron-to-wallclock conversion in the dispatch loop. On-call should verify partition completeness before re-enqueueing, since duplicate backfills will double-count metrics downstream. The failing run is identified by the token below.

pipeline stamp: htk9_ce63042d9

**Handover — password reset revamp (Bramblewyn SDK)**

Plugin authors: the legacy reset hooks are deprecated. New flow uses signed challenge tokens; your plugins must implement the `onResetChallenge` callback before the next minor release or resets will fail silently. Migration guide is in the docs tree. Test fixtures updated; the old sandbox tokens no longer validate. I'm rotating off this project Friday. Direct all compatibility questions to the new owner, named below.

approver of yawig-yajef = Briius Jorix

## Deployment

Vexcel evaluates user-supplied formulas inside the Quillbox sandbox. No formula touches the host runtime. Each deploy spins up a fresh sandbox pool; stale pools are drained within ten minutes. If a formula escapes resource limits, the pool is killed, not the node. Do not deploy without the sandbox image pinned. The deploy job reads the following settings at boot.

deployment values, bagaf-kagag:
istael:
  pin: 2777
  tenant: tamvan
  seal: seal_75cefd5e
  metrics_host: metrics.istael.qirvanio.example
  standby_team: holion
  escalation: kelmir-drudor
  nonce: d13cd7

## Fire-Drill Roll Call — Night Shift (Brennar House)

When the alarm sounds after 22:00, the duty supervisor takes the roll-call clipboard from the lobby cabinet and proceeds to Assembly Point C, the gravel yard behind the loading bay. Count every person present against the night roster, including visitors signed in at the desk. Report discrepancies to the fire warden immediately. To re-enter the building once the all-clear is given, use the night-shift door pass below.

door code, yagap-bahof: bdg-O-05